The most engagingly written, clinically relevant overview of the practice of anesthesiologyHailed as the best primer on the topic, Morgan and Mikhail's Clinical Anesthesiology has remained true to its stated goal: "to provide a concise, consistent presentation of the basic principles essential to the modern practice of anesthesia."This trusted classic delivers comprehensive coverage of the field's must-know basic science and clinical topics in a clear, easy-to-understand presentation.

At the same time, it has retained its value for coursework, review, and as a clinical refresher.Key features that make it easier to understand complex topics:Rich full-color art work combined with a modern, user-friendly design make information easy to find and rememberCase discussions promote application of concepts in real-world clinical practiceBoxed Key Concepts at the beginning of each chapter identify important issues and facts that underlie the specialtyNumerous tables and figures encapsulate important information and facilitate recallUp-to-date discussion of all relevant areas of anesthesiology, including equipment and monitors, pharmacology, pathophysiology, regional anesthesia, pain management, and critical care
